探讨静态网站制作的要点与技巧-如何高效完成静态网站制作

教程大全 2026-01-19 06:40:22 浏览

静态网站的制作

静态网站的定义

静态网站是指网页内容固定不变,每次访问时都从服务器上直接读取并显示的网站,与动态网站相比,静态网站的制作相对简单,更新和维护成本较低,以下是制作静态网站的基本步骤。

制作静态网站的基本步骤

确定网站主题和内容

在制作静态网站之前,首先要明确网站的主题和内容,这包括确定网站的目标受众、提供的信息类型以及网站的整体风格。

设计网站结构

根据网站主题和内容,设计网站的整体结构,这包括确定网站的页面数量、页面布局以及页面之间的链接关系。

选择合适的网页制作工具

静态网站优化方法与技巧

有许多网页制作工具可供选择,如Adobe Dreamweaver、Microsoft Expression Web、Sublime Text等,根据个人喜好和需求,选择一款适合自己的网页制作工具。

制作网页

使用选择的网页制作工具,开始制作网页,主要包括以下步骤:

(1)创建网页文件:在网页制作工具中,新建一个HTML文件。

(2)设置网页标题和描述:在HTML文件的标签中,设置网页的标题和描述。

(3)设计网页布局:使用表格、div等元素,设计网页的布局。

(4)添加网页内容:在网页的标签中,添加文字、图片、音频、视频等元素。

(5)优化网页代码:对HTML、CSS、JavaScript等代码进行优化,提高网页的加载速度和兼容性。

测试网页

在本地或远程服务器上,测试网页的显示效果、功能以及兼容性,确保网页在各种浏览器和设备上都能正常显示。

上传网页

将制作好的网页上传到服务器,使网站对外可见。

静态网站制作技巧

使用简洁的HTML结构

尽量使用简洁的HTML结构,避免使用过多的嵌套标签,提高网页的加载速度。

优化图片和视频

对图片和视频进行压缩,减小文件大小,提高网页的加载速度。

使用CSS进行样式设计

使用CSS进行样式设计,避免在HTML代码中直接添加样式,提高代码的可读性和可维护性。

遵循响应式设计原则

根据不同设备屏幕尺寸,设计响应式网页,提高用户体验。

Q1:静态网站与动态网站有什么区别?

A1:静态网站的内容固定不变,每次访问时都从服务器上直接读取并显示;而动态网站的内容可以实时更新,根据用户请求动态生成。

Q2:制作静态网站需要学习哪些技术?

A2:制作静态网站需要学习HTML、CSS、JavaScript等前端技术,以及图片处理、视频剪辑等辅助技能。


如何建一个静态的网站

建议不要采用静态网站,以后你维护是个比较麻烦的事,除非你的页面发布后不再更改静态网站实现有好几种办法:1、使用CMS来生成HTML静态页;2、采用urlRewrite来重写URL来达到静态化;

网页制作怎么弄

如果你想学习简单做静态网页:1.熟练掌握HTML2.看懂JAVASCRIPT3.会一点PHOTOSHOP、FLASH、dreamweaver4.到网上下载好的个人主页模板进行修改如果你学深入学习做交互(动态)网页:1.熟练掌握HTML2.精通VBSCRIPT,了解JAVASCRIPT3.了解CSS4.会操作PHOTOSHOP(抠图)、FLASH、dreamweaver5.掌握一门数据库(access/sqlserver)6.精通ASP或者7.了解域名、空间的概念8.了解SEO技术

如何生成静态页面?

具体实现上又有这两种方法1. 管理后台添加记录时,直接生成目标html页面,并且前台调用连接直接指向生成的html页面。 这种方法程优点是程序效率最高。 服务器负荷轻,不过由于生成的是纯静态页面,一旦页面样式(模版及css=theme)上有所改动就必须重新生成所有的内容页。 所以实际使用中应用一般不是太多。 更多的是使用js,ssi,xml/xsl等客户端手段,生成的静态文件中仅保存数据,不涉及样式,这样能达到速度和维护性的平衡,不过相对前后台程序要复杂些(应用这种方法时,由于内容为纯静态,可以搭配单独编译的纯静态的apache使用。 。 效率和资源占用上比包含动态内容支持的要更佳)====补充: a. 上面说的改动样式,要重新生成所有的内容页,可以通过: >>>>在可以在每个生成的页面内嵌入一个来判断 是否需要重新生成该页面。 >>>>apache 的errorDocument404 功能, 但是这里前台链接是指向html的,如果该html不存在, 会通过apache的文件不存在重定向到404处理程序的功能重新生成html(注加 ErrorDocument 404 / 指令), 利用这个功能可以解决修改网站样式的时候,要更新所有生成的html文件的问题, 将整个static文件夹删除即可。 b. 通过嵌入js来调用php的方式,更改许多需要变化的地方(如点击率之类的)2. 前台访问链接指向php程序,php程序首先检查是否存在相应的静态文件。 如果静态文件不存在。 则生成并重定向至此文件,否则直接重定向。 这种方法实际使用中一般和apache的url_rewrite功能一起使用。 将php的文件地址重显示为html的形式,有利于搜索引擎的检索。 这种方法在效率上略有损失,不过程序结构简单,便于调整,在访问量不是很大时使用很合适。 。 注意事项:所有生成的html文件都集中放到一个文件夹, 其中还应该注意生成文件如果很多的话(如论坛),访问其中一个htm文件,将会变得很慢,那么最好通过>>>>按日期来分隔文件夹,如static/2004/11/18/>>>>对帖子id根据数据库中字段长度做str_pad:比方说id为,数据库中为int(11),则id处理为,考虑到Linux下一般同一下文件到达四位数会有性能影响,对其做切割,最后路径为static/00/000/123/

本文版权声明本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请联系本站客服,一经查实,本站将立刻删除。

发表评论

热门推荐